Manchester based
James Roper's
paintings, illustrations and drawings are completely off the chain. He
has such and amazing grasp of motion, colour and light and his
versatility in technique is equally as inspirational as it is
intimidating. Some of his pieces share a very strong resemblance to
artist
Zach Johnsen
and as both have had an involvement with clothing label Tank Theory
there's been some obvious cross pollination there. There's also some
parallels that can be drawn between his pencil work and that of
Australia's
Jonathan Zawada, but in saying that his explosive colour paintings are fantastically fresh and original. I'm a massive fan.
